Emergency plumbing includes sudden, major leaks, burst pipes, or sewage backups. These situations can cause significant damage quickly. Ignoring them can lead to bigger problems. We are your 24 hour plumber near me for these urgent needs.
If you have a burst pipe, a significant leak, or sewage backing up, act fast. These issues can cause extensive damage to your home very quickly. Don't delay in calling for help. We are here to respond.
